Bitfinex实时价格查询指南:网站与API详解

时间: 分类:动态 阅读:54

Bitfinex 如何查询实时市场价格

Bitfinex 作为一家老牌的加密货币交易所,提供多种查询实时市场价格的方式。对于交易者和投资者来说,快速准确地获取价格信息至关重要,这直接影响他们的交易决策。以下将详细介绍在 Bitfinex 平台上查询实时市场价格的几种主要方法。

一、Bitfinex 网站界面实时价格查看

这是获取加密货币实时价格最直观、最直接的方式,同时也是最常用的方法。用户只需访问 Bitfinex 官方网站,无需登录账户,便可立即浏览到包括比特币 (BTC)、以太坊 (ETH)、莱特币 (LTC) 等主要加密货币的最新市场报价,以及其他交易对的实时价格信息。Bitfinex 的网页界面通常会显示买入价 (Bid Price)、卖出价 (Ask Price)、最高价 (High Price)、最低价 (Low Price) 以及成交量 (Volume) 等关键数据,帮助用户快速了解市场动态。

首页行情面板: 网站首页通常会显示比特币(BTC)、以太坊(ETH)等主流加密货币的实时价格。这些价格以简洁明了的方式呈现,包括当前价格、24小时涨跌幅、24小时最高价和最低价等关键信息。你可以快速了解市场的整体走势。
  • 交易界面: 进入具体的交易对界面,例如 BTC/USD、ETH/BTC 等,你会看到更详细的实时价格信息。交易界面通常包含以下要素:
    • K线图: K线图是技术分析的重要工具,它以图形化的方式展示了价格随时间的变化。你可以选择不同的时间周期(如1分钟、5分钟、1小时、1天等)来查看历史价格走势。通过观察K线图,你可以分析市场的趋势和潜在的交易机会。
    • 深度图(Order Book): 深度图展示了买单和卖单的挂单情况。买单深度显示了在不同价格水平上等待买入的订单数量,卖单深度则显示了等待卖出的订单数量。通过观察深度图,你可以了解市场的供需关系,从而判断价格的支撑位和阻力位。
    • 最新成交价(Last Price): 这是最近一笔成交的价格,也是最实时的价格信息。
    • 买一价(Bid Price)和卖一价(Ask Price): 买一价是市场上最高的买入报价,卖一价是市场上最低的卖出报价。两者之间的差额被称为“价差(Spread)”。
    • 交易量(Volume): 交易量显示了在一定时间内该交易对的成交量。高交易量通常意味着市场活跃,价格波动可能更大。
  • 二、Bitfinex API 接口获取实时价格

    对于开发者和寻求自动化交易解决方案的交易者而言,通过 Bitfinex API 接口获取实时价格数据是更加高效且灵活的选择。Bitfinex 提供了 REST API 和 WebSocket API 两种主要方式来满足不同的数据获取需求。

    1. REST API

      Bitfinex REST API 允许通过发送 HTTP 请求来获取各种市场数据,包括最新的交易价格。你需要构造包含特定参数的 URL,并发送 GET 请求到 Bitfinex 的服务器。返回的数据通常是 JSON 格式,包含了你需要的价格信息。例如,你可以获取特定交易对(如 BTC/USD)的最新成交价、最高价、最低价和交易量等数据。这种方式的优点是简单易用,适合对数据实时性要求不高的应用场景。但需要注意的是,频繁地调用 REST API 可能会受到速率限制的影响,因此需要合理地控制请求频率。

    2. WebSocket API

      Bitfinex WebSocket API 提供了实时数据推送服务。与 REST API 不同,WebSocket 允许建立一个持久连接,服务器会主动将最新的价格更新推送到客户端,而无需客户端主动发送请求。这种方式可以实现近乎实时的价格更新,适用于对数据延迟非常敏感的交易策略。你需要编写代码来建立 WebSocket 连接,并订阅特定的频道(如交易对的ticker频道)。一旦建立连接并成功订阅,你就可以持续接收来自服务器的价格更新。WebSocket API 的优势在于低延迟和高效率,但同时也需要更复杂的编程实现。

    REST API: REST API 允许你通过发送 HTTP 请求来获取市场数据。例如,你可以使用 GET /v1/pubticker/:symbol 端点来获取特定交易对的最新市场信息,包括最新成交价、买一价、卖一价、交易量等。使用 REST API 的优点是简单易用,但缺点是数据更新频率相对较低。

    GET /v1/pubticker/btcusd

    返回的 JSON 数据示例:

    { "mid": "4295.05", "bid": "4295.0", "ask": "4295.1", "last_price": "4295.09999999", "low": "4196.14", "high": "4328", "volume": "7237.7444155", "timestamp": "1506932565.308707352" }

  • WebSocket API: WebSocket API 允许你建立一个持久的连接,交易所会将实时数据推送给你。这种方式的优点是数据更新频率非常高,几乎是实时的,适合高频交易和算法交易。Bitfinex 提供了不同的 WebSocket 频道,你可以订阅特定的频道来获取你需要的数据。例如,你可以订阅 ticker 频道来获取特定交易对的最新价格信息。

    你需要先建立 WebSocket 连接,然后发送订阅消息:

    { "event": "subscribe", "channel": "ticker", "symbol": "tBTCUSD" }

    交易所会推送实时数据,例如:

    [ 2, [ 4295, // BID 10, // BIDSIZE 4295.1, // ASK 20, // ASKSIZE 4295.09999999, // DAILYCHANGE 23.869, // DAILYCHANGEPERC 4328, // LASTPRICE 7237.7444155, // VOLUME 4196.14 // HIGH 4328 // LOW ] ]

  • 三、第三方交易平台和行情软件

    除了直接依赖 Bitfinex 官方渠道获取数据,交易者还可以利用众多第三方交易平台和行情软件来追踪 Bitfinex 交易所的实时市场价格变动。 这些平台和软件聚合了来自多个加密货币交易所的数据,为用户提供更全面的市场概览,简化了跨交易所价格比较和技术分析的流程。 用户可以通过比较不同交易所的价格,发现潜在的套利机会,或者验证官方数据的准确性。 常见的第三方平台包括但不限于:TradingView、CoinMarketCap、CoinGecko、Coinbase、Binance Info 等。

    • TradingView: 提供高级图表工具和社交交易功能,允许用户自定义指标和分享交易策略。其强大的绘图功能和丰富的技术指标,能够帮助用户更深入地分析 Bitfinex 上的交易对。TradingView 还支持实时数据流,确保用户获得最新的价格信息。
    • CoinMarketCap: 提供全面的加密货币市场数据,包括价格、交易量、市值等。用户可以查看 Bitfinex 上所有上市交易对的历史数据和实时价格,并与其他交易所进行比较。
    • CoinGecko: 专注于提供独立和透明的加密货币数据,包括 Bitfinex 的信任评分、流动性指标和开发者活动。CoinGecko 还提供API接口,方便开发者集成其数据到自己的应用中。
    • 其他平台:诸如Coinbase, Binance Info等平台也提供类似的功能,用户可以根据自己的需求选择合适的平台。
    TradingView: TradingView 提供了强大的图表分析工具,你可以选择 Bitfinex 作为数据源,查看K线图、深度图等,并使用各种技术指标进行分析。
  • CoinMarketCap 和 CoinGecko: 这些平台提供了各种加密货币的实时价格、市值、交易量等信息,你可以搜索特定的交易对(例如 BTC/USD on Bitfinex)来查看实时价格。
  • 四、移动App

    Bitfinex 官方提供了移动App,旨在为用户提供便捷的交易体验,随时随地掌握市场动态。这款App的设计理念与网页版平台保持一致,用户能够迅速适应其操作界面,高效获取所需信息。

    App 界面通常复刻了网站的核心功能,包括但不限于各类加密货币的实时价格显示、详尽的K线图分析工具、直观的深度图展示等。更重要的是,移动App集成了完整的交易功能,用户可以直接在App上执行买卖操作,无需依赖电脑终端,极大提升了交易的灵活性和效率。Bitfinex移动App还支持自定义价格提醒,一旦达到预设价格,将即时推送通知,帮助用户捕捉每一个交易机会。

    无论用户选择网页端API接口、第三方平台或者Bitfinex官方App,都需要牢记以下关键原则,以保障交易的安全性和准确性:

    • 选择可靠的数据源: 数据的准确性是交易决策的基石。务必选用信誉良好、数据更新及时的供应商,避免因不实或延迟的价格信息导致错误的判断,进而影响交易结果。可信赖的数据源通常会公开其数据获取和验证流程,确保透明度和可靠性。
    • 关注价差(Bid-Ask Spread): 在执行交易指令前,务必密切关注买一价(Bid)和卖一价(Ask)之间的价差。较大的价差意味着更高的交易成本,尤其是在高频交易或大额交易中,可能会显著降低盈利空间。可以通过选择流动性更好的交易对,或使用限价单等策略来降低价差带来的影响。
    • 注意市场波动: 加密货币市场以其高度波动性而闻名。价格可能在短时间内经历剧烈波动,这既带来了潜在的收益机会,也蕴含着相应的风险。投资者应充分了解市场特性,制定完善的风险管理策略,例如设置止损单,以控制潜在损失。同时,应避免过度杠杆,以免放大风险。
    • 及时更新: 市场信息瞬息万变,尤其在高频交易环境下,数据的实时性至关重要。确保使用的平台或App能够提供最新的价格信息,避免因信息滞后而做出错误的交易决策。部分平台提供实时数据流API,可以以毫秒级的速度获取市场数据,适用于对时间敏感的交易策略。

    综上所述,无论是采用API接口、第三方平台或是官方App,都旨在为用户提供多渠道、便捷的Bitfinex实时市场价格获取途径。通过充分利用这些工具,并严格遵循上述注意事项,用户可以更加自信地参与加密货币交易,做出更明智的投资决策,并在瞬息万变的市场中把握机遇。

    相关推荐: